<sect3 id="contact-bugs"><title>Reporting Bugs</title>
<para>
 Please report all bugs <emphasis>only</emphasis> through our
 bug tracker: 
 <ulink url="http://sourceforge.net/tracker/?group_id=11118&amp;atid=111118">http://sourceforge.net/tracker/?group_id=11118&amp;atid=111118</ulink>. 
</para>

<para>
  Before doing so, please make sure that the bug has <emphasis>not already been submitted</emphasis>
  and observe the additional hints at the top of the <ulink
  url="http://sourceforge.net/tracker/?func=add&amp;group_id=11118&amp;atid=111118">submit
  form</ulink>. If already submitted, please feel free to add any info to the 
  original report that might help to solve the issue.
</para>

<para> 
  Please try to verify that it is a <application>Privoxy</application> bug,
  and not a browser or site bug first. If unsure,
  try <ulink url="http://config.privoxy.org/toggle?set=disable">toggling
  off</ulink> <application>Privoxy</application>, and see if the problem persists.
  If you are using your own custom configuration, please try
  the stock configs to see if the problem is configuration related.
</para>

<para>
  If not using the latest version, the bug may have been found
  and fixed in the meantime. We would appreciate if you could take the time
  to <ulink url="http://www.privoxy.org/user-manual/installation.html">upgrade
  to the latest version</ulink> (or  even the latest CVS snapshot) and verify
  your bug.
</para>
<para>
Please be sure to provide the following information:
</para>
<para>
 <itemizedlist>

  <listitem>
   <para>
    The exact <application>Privoxy</application> version of the proxy software
    (if you got the source from CVS, please also provide the source code revisions
     as shown in <ulink url="http://config.privoxy.org/show-version">http://config.privoxy.org/show-version</ulink>).
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    The operating system and versions you run
    <application>Privoxy</application> on, (e.g. <application>Windows
    XP SP2</application>), if you are using a Unix flavor,
    sending the output of <quote>uname -a</quote> should do.
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    The name, platform, and version of the <application>browser</application> 
    you were using (e.g. <application>Internet Explorer v5.5</application> for Mac).
   </para>
  </listitem>

  <listitem>
   <para>
    The URL where the problem occurred, or some way for us to duplicate the
    problem (e.g. <literal>http://somesite.example.com/?somethingelse=123</literal>). 
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    Whether your version of <application>Privoxy</application> is one supplied
    by the developers of <application>Privoxy</application> via SourceForge,
    or somewhere else.
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    Whether you are using <application>Privoxy</application> in tandem with 
    another proxy such as <application>Tor</application>. If so, please try 
    disabling the other proxy.
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    Whether you are using a personal firewall product. If so, does 
    <application>Privoxy</application> work without it?
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    Any other pertinent information to help identify the problem such as config
    or log file excerpts (yes, you should have log file entries for each
    action taken).
   </para>
  </listitem> 

  <listitem>
   <para>
    <emphasis>Please provide your SF login, or email address</emphasis>, in case we 
    need to contact you.
   </para>
  </listitem> 

</itemizedlist>
</para>
<para>
  The <ulink url="http://www.privoxy.org/user-manual/appendix.html#ACTIONSANAT">appendix
  of the Privoxy User Manual</ulink> also has helpful information 
  on understanding <literal>actions</literal>, and <literal>action</literal> debugging. 
</para>
